Strong's References
- H205 — אָוֶן (ʼâven, aw-ven'): from an unused root perhaps meaning properly, to pant (hence, to exert oneself, usually in vain; to come to naught); strictly nothingness; also trouble. vanity, wickedness; specifically an idol; affliction, evil, false, idol, iniquity, mischief, mourners(-ing), naught, sorrow, unjust, unrighteous, vain, vanity, wicked(-ness). Compare אַיִן.
- H343 — אֵיד (ʼêyd, ade): from the same as אוּד (in the sense of bending down); oppression; by implication misfortune, ruin; calamity, destruction.
- H5235 — נֶכֶר (neker, neh'-ker): or נֹכֶר; from נָכַר; something strange, i.e. unexpected calamity; strange.
- H5767 — עַוָּל (ʻavvâl, av-vawl'): intensive from עֲוַל; evil (morally); unjust, unrighteous, wicked.
- H6466 — פָּעַל (pâʻal, paw-al'): a primitive root; to do or make (systematically and habitually), especially to practise; commit, (evil-) do(-er), make(-r), ordain, work(-er).
